Beautifully presented and well-appointed ground floor apartment situated at the end of a cul-de-sac within this popular and sought-after development close to the centre of Stepps and the train station as well as having ease of access to the M80.
Designed for the rigours of a modern lifestyle this bright, tastefully presented, two bedroomed apartment will undoubtedly be of wide appeal as the style and location combine to provide the components for life in the twenty first century. Being on the ground floor, the property is likely to appeal to a wide spectrum from first time buyers to those considering down-sizing or perhaps the elderly or less active. The generously proportioned accommodation comprises: Entrance hall with built-in cupboard and utility cupboard with washing machine and door intercom entry hand set, spacious open plan lounge/dining/kitchen including built-under double oven and integral gas hob plus integrated fridge/freezer and dishwasher, two well-proportioned double bedrooms one of which has built-in wardrobes and bathroom with three piece white suite including bath with shower over. This outstanding apartment is further enhanced by gas central heating, PVC double glazed window frames, allocated resident parking space, communal parking for visitors and communal grounds.

Located off Cardowan Road (behind Bannatyne Health Club), Scapa Way, is well placed close to the centre of Stepps and is about 5 minutes walk from the train station. The A80 is also nearby which provides access to the M80 which is ideal from commuting by road to both Glasgow and Stirling.

Sold house price data is supplied to us by the Registers of Scotland, a government department responsible for compiling and maintaining property registers, every month. There can be a delay of up to 3 months from when a property is sold to being recorded with Registers of Scotland.
